Flatpicking Guitar Lessons
If you love bluegrass and folk music, you'll enjoy these lessons from some of the best flatpickers around. Many more great guitar lessons can be found on our main Lessons page.

Arpeggios and Melodies (Part 1 of 2)

Learn the basics of Celtic flatpicking from Paul Kotapish. Features the simple Irish reel 'Walker Street.'

Arpeggios and Melodies (Part 2 of 2)

Continue the Celtic flatpicking with arpeggios lesson, and learn the Irish jig 'Tripping up the Stairs.'

Bluesy Bluegrass Lead

Fiddle tunes and G-runs will get you off to a good start in bluegrass, but to really get that lonesome guitar sound, you need to come down with a bad case of the blues now and then.

Chords and Melodies up the Neck

A lesson in how to play chords and melodies up the neck. Includes three versions of the song 'Forked Deer.'

Crosspicking Pop Songs

Use simple crosspicking techniques to create full, driving acompaniments to pop tunes, country songs, or any other song you can think of.

Down in the Valley to Pray

AG editor Scott Nygaard explains how to play his version of the classic spiritual.

Flatpicking Celtic Syle

With the right feel, phrasing, and a few authentic ornaments, you can play Irish fiddle tunes like you're from the old country.

Flatpicking Fiddle Tunes (Part 1 of 2)

Take a free on-line lesson with flatpick wizard Scott Nygaard.
Learn to play 'Soldier's Joy.'

Flatpicking Fiddle Tunes (Part 2 of 2): Second Fiddle

Continue the flatpicking lesson with Scott Nygaard.
Learn to play two versions of 'Sandy River Belle.'

Play It Loud

Increase your flatpicking volume—without sacrificing tone—with these seven adjustments to your technique and attitude.

The Art of Guitar Picking


Learn to choose and effectively use a flatpick. Plus, a full-length interview with flatpicking master Beppe Gambetta.
* How to find the best pick to suit your style.
* Learn 3 easy flatpicking techniques—the downstroke, alternate picking, and sweep picking. Includes audio examples.
* Beppe Gambetta shows his cross-picking technique, with video.
